Activities Program Trufforum New York

The prized “Black Diamond” of cuisine -The Tuber Melanosporum Truffle

Monday, February 10th, 2025 | Marriott Pavilion, Hyde Park, New York

Coordination: Joaquin Latorre Minguell (EMI), Nahuel Pazos (BCC) and Fernando Martínez Peña (CAA-INIA-CSIC)


9:00 am
Welcome and Introduction

Kick off the day with a warm welcome and an overview of what to expect.
Jason Potanovich, Associate Dean-Restaurant Education and Volume Production, CIA New York, Begoña Rodríguez Romera, Director at BCC Innovation and Joaquin Latorre Minguell, General Secretary EMI.

9:10 am

The Black Truffle: An Exploration

Join Fernando Martínez-Peña (CCA-INIA-CSIC) and María Martín Santafé (CITA) as they delve into the fascinating world of black truffles, covering their description, history, ecology, species, and key production areas.

9:20 am
Truffle Hunting Adventures

Discover the art of truffle hunting with experts Javier López and Feli Sánchez from Encitruf in Soria (Spain).

9:30 am
Selecting and Preserving Truffles.

Learn how to choose the best truffles, assess their quality, and preserve them effectively. Jaime Olaizola from IdForest will also discuss imitation aromas.

9:40 am
Truffle Tourism in Europe

Explore the exciting world of truffle tourism across Europe with Joaquin Latorre from EMI (EU)

9:50 am
The Teruel Black Truffle Experiential Park

Daniel Brito García-Mascaraque from Atruter in Teruel (Spain), the world’s leading black truffle production region, will take you on a tour of this unique park dedicated to black truffles.

10:00 am
Guided Tasting of Black Truffle (Tuber melanosporum)

Join Alexandra Pérez and María Jesús Salvador from the Atruter tasting panel in Teruel for a delightful guided tasting experience.

10:30-11:30 am
Culinary Demonstrations Featuring Black Truffle

Join Nahuel Pazos and Jonathan Pommerenk, research chefs at the Basque Culinary Centre Innovation (BCC-Innovation) in San Sebastián, for an exclusive culinary demonstration. We will also be joined by the winner of the prestigious international competition ‘Cooking with Truffle,’ organized by the Junta de Castilla y León (Spain).

11:30 am
Questions and Learning Assessment

Engage in a session with Fernando Martínez-Peña (INIA-CSIC) and María Martín Santafé (CITA) to reinforce your learning.

12:00 am
Closing Remarks

Wrap up the day with final thoughts and reflections.
